About Allambie Heights 2100

The size of Allambie Heights is approximately 6.5 square kilometres. It has 19 parks covering nearly 59.4% of total area. The population of Allambie Heights in 2011 was 6,741 people. By 2016 the population was 7,001 showing a population growth of 3.9%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Allambie Heights is 40-49 years. Households in Allambie Heights are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Allambie Heights work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 77.2% of the homes in Allambie Heights were owner-occupied compared with 78.3% in 2016.

Allambie Heights has 2,577 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Allambie Heights have seen a 68.26%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 37.29% increase. As at 30 September 2024:

  • The median value for Houses in Allambie Heights is $2,507,017 while the median value for Units is $1,209,171.
  • Houses have a median rent of $1,168 while Units have a median rent of $555.
